1. Understand the Local Market

Before you put your house up for sale, it’s crucial to understand the local market in San Diego. Knowing the market trends can help you set a realistic price and attract more buyers.

Start by looking at recent sales in your area. This will give you an idea of how much homes are selling for and how quickly they are moving. Pay attention to the time of year when homes sell the fastest; this can help you decide the best time to list your house.

Keep an eye on the competition in your neighborhood. Notice the unique features and improvements of other properties and how they contribute to their overall value. This can help you make your home stand out.

Flexibility in pricing shows a realistic approach and can attract more interest from potential buyers.

2. Set the Stage for a Quick Sale

Setting the stage for a quick sale is all about making your home look its best. First impressions matter. When buyers walk in, they should feel like they could live there. This means arranging your furniture to show off the space and adding small touches like fresh flowers or a neatly set dining table.

  • Declutter: Remove personal items and excess furniture to make rooms look bigger.
  • Clean: A spotless home feels more inviting. Pay attention to windows, floors, and even the smell of your home.
  • Neutral Decor: Use neutral colors to appeal to a wider range of buyers.

Staging before the photographer shows up provides excellent pictures for the listing. It also gives buyers a positive experience when they visit.

Remember, staging doesn’t have to be expensive. Simple changes can make a big difference in how fast your home sells.

3. List on MLS

Listing your home on the Multiple Listing Service (MLS) is a crucial step to ensure maximum exposure. An MLS listing can attract numerous potential buyers, increasing your chances of a quick sale. Here’s how you can list your home on the MLS:

  1. Choose a Listing Service: You can either hire a real estate agent or use a flat-fee MLS service like Houzeo. The latter allows you to list your home without paying high agent commissions.
  2. Complete the Paperwork: This typically includes the listing agreement and any necessary disclosures about your property.
  3. Prepare Your Home: Make sure your home is staged and ready for photos. Professional photos can help sell your home faster.
  4. Set Your Price: Price your home competitively to attract more buyers.
  5. List Your Home: Once everything is ready, submit your listing to the MLS.

Listing on the MLS can significantly boost your home’s visibility, making it easier to attract serious buyers quickly.

4. Sell to a ‘We Buy Houses for Cash’ Company

Selling to a ‘We Buy Houses for Cash’ company can be a quick and easy way to sell your home in San Diego. These companies offer instant cash offers and can close deals in as little as 10 to 15 days. This means you can sell your house as-is without spending money on repairs.

However, it’s important to note that these companies typically offer only 30% to 70% of your home’s market value. This trade-off allows for a faster sale but at a lower price.

  • Instant cash offers
  • Close within 10 to 15 days
  • Sell as-is, no repairs needed
  • Offers typically 30% to 70% of market value

If you’re in a hurry to move, selling to a cash homebuying company can be a viable option. Just be prepared to accept a lower offer for the convenience and speed of the sale.

6. Price Your Home Competitively

Setting the right price for your home is crucial to attracting buyers quickly. Price it too high, and you might scare off potential buyers. Price it too low, and you could end up disappointed with the offers you receive. To find the sweet spot, compare your home to similar properties that have recently sold in your area.

Work closely with your real estate agent to determine a competitive price. They can provide a comparative market analysis (CMA) to help you understand current market trends and how your home’s unique features contribute to its value. Here are some factors to consider:

  • Current market trends
  • Inventory levels
  • Recent comparable sale prices
  • Unique features and improvements of your property

Be open to adjusting your listing price if necessary. Flexibility can attract more interest from potential buyers and set the stage for a quicker sale.

Remember, pricing your home competitively is a balancing act. If done right, you might even set the stage for a bidding war, especially if buyers are enticed by the price and the home’s features.

9. Make Necessary Repairs

When selling your house, it’s crucial to address any repairs that need attention. Small fixes can have a big impact on how potential buyers perceive your home. A dripping tap or a squeaky door might seem minor, but they can be turn-offs for buyers.

Before listing your property, consider the following steps:

  1. Patch any holes in the walls or roof.
  2. Ensure your HVAC system is up to code.
  3. Fix any plumbing issues, like leaks or clogs.
  4. Repair or replace broken windows and doors.

Taking care of these repairs shows that your home has been well-cared-for, which can translate to a quicker sale.

Ignoring these issues can lead to buyers using them as reasons to lower their offers or even back out of the deal. By making necessary repairs, you increase the chances of a smooth and fast sale.
